What is a dust extractor used for?

A dust extractor, also known as a dust collector, is a machine used to capture and collect dust particles from the air. It is usually used by professional tradesmen, such as woodworkers and mechanics, to protect the air quality in garages or workshops.

Dust extractors typically work by drawing in polluted air and passing it through a filter system that traps the dust particles. The filtered air is then exhausted back into the environment. The collected dust is then typically collected in a receptacle or dust bag for disposal.

Dust extractors can be an effective tool for reducing air contaminants, improving air quality, and preventing dust from settling on machinery, tools, and other areas.

What’s the difference between dust collector and shop vac?

The main difference between a dust collector and a shop vac is the size and power of the machine. A dust collector is typically a much larger, stationary machine. It is placed in a shop or garage and connected directly to a central dust collection system.

A dust collector has a powerful vacuum that can quickly and efficiently pick up debris and dust particles, allowing them to be disposed of properly.

A shop vac, on the other hand, is much smaller and lighter in size. It is a portable vacuum that is typically used to clean up smaller messes in the home or garage. Shop vacs can also be used to pick up debris and dust particles, but they are not as powerful as dust collectors, so they are not suitable for commercial or industrial uses.

Shop vacs are designed for residential use, making them ideal for vacuuming up dirt, sawdust, and small pieces of debris.

What can I use for dust collection?

There are a variety of products available to use for dust collection. Many are designed specifically for a certain type of dust or application. Depending on the types of materials and processes being used, an appropriate dust collection system may include a blower, filter, dust filter bag, collection drum, vacuum, or any combination of these.

For smaller, shop-style applications such as woodworking, a cyclone dust collector, bag filter, or a box filter are all capable of providing reliable dust collection. These systems often also include mounting and connection fittings, with a wide variety of shapes and sizes available to fit specific needs.

Applications such as sand blasting or other blasting techniques may require a combination of a dust collector and a vacuum. In these cases, a blower, filter, dust filter bag, collection drum, and a specialized industrial-grade vacuum system can ensure effective dust collection.

In some industries or applications, an electrostatic dust collection device may be the most appropriate solution. These systems use electricity to trap dust particles, providing an efficient way of collecting and containing airborne dust.

No matter the size, scope, or application of a particular project or job, a suitable dust collection system can help to collect and contain potentially hazardous particles, increasing worker safety and eliminating unnecessary cleanup.

Is a dust collector better than a shop vac?

Whether a dust collector is better than a shop vac really depends on the application. Dust collectors generally provide better filtration than shop vacs, and can handle much larger volumes of sawdust and other materials with greater efficiency.

They can also be connected to multiple machines, making it easier to manage multiple dirt-producing tools. On the other hand, shop vacs are typically much more affordable and much more portable than dust collectors, and are often sufficient for smaller woodworking tasks like cleanup and finish work.

Ultimately, the choice between a dust collector and a shop vac should depend on the user’s specific needs and budget.

How do you dust proof a table saw?

Table saws are an essential piece of equipment for woodworking projects, but their exterior surfaces can be prone to gathering dust and debris. To keep your table saw in good operating condition and ensure the accuracy of your cutting jobs, it is important to dust proof it.

Here are some tips for dust-proofing a table saw:

1. Install a dust collection system. Connecting your table saw to a dust collection system can significantly reduce the amount of dust and debris buildup on the exterior of the saw. This type of system typically includes a dust port that attaches to the motor and a hose which can be attached to a vacuum.

2. Seal the cabinet. Sealing the cabinet of your table saw helps to reduce the amount of dust that accumulates on the saw. You can use an airtight gasket sealant to do this.

3. Use a cover. Placing a cover over your table saw when it’s not in use helps keep it dust and debris free. You can find specially designed covers made of plastic or canvas that are designed specifically for table saws.

By following these tips, you can keep your table saw dust-proof and in good working condition.
